本文详细介绍了在Kali Linux下配置L2TP VPN的步骤,包括安装必要的软件包、配置VPN服务器和客户端、设置加密参数,以及连接和断开VPN连接的方法。教程旨在帮助用户顺利搭建并使用L2TP VPN,确保网络连接的安全性和隐私性。
1、[L2TP简介](#id1)
![L2TP VPN 配置图示](https://oss-emcsprod-public.modb.pro/wechatSpider/modb_20211123_86d58114-4c42-11ec-ae8c-fa163eb4f6be.png)
随着互联网的广泛应用,用户对网络安全和个人隐私保护的意识日益增强,VPN(虚拟私人网络)作为一种加密的网络连接技术,能够有效保障用户数据安全,防止信息泄露,本文将深入解析如何在Kali Linux系统中配置L2TP VPN,以实现高效的安全连接。
L2TP简介
L2TP(第二层隧道协议)是一种基于IPsec的VPN协议,它融合了PPTP和L2F的优点,能够在公共网络上创建安全的隧道,从而为用户提供安全的远程访问,以下是L2TP协议的主要特点:
1、协议兼容性:支持多种网络协议,如TCP/IP、IPX等。
2、安全增强:能与IPsec结合,显著提升安全性。
3、动态IP分配:支持动态IP地址的分配。
4、多种认证方式:包括PAP、CHAP等多种认证机制。
Kali Linux下配置L2TP VPN
1. 安装L2TP VPN服务器
在Kali Linux上,我们需要安装L2TP VPN服务器,以下是具体的安装命令:
sudo apt-get update sudo apt-get install strongswan
安装完成后,服务器默认启用IPsec,但我们需要关闭它并启用L2TP服务。
2. 配置L2TP VPN服务器
编辑IPsec配置文件:
sudo nano /etc/ipsec.conf
在文件中添加以下内容:
config setup charondebug="ike 2, knl 2, cfg 2, net 2, esp 2, dmn 2, knl 2, cfg 2, net 2, esp 2, dmn 2" uniqueids=no conn L2TP-PSK left=%defaultroute leftsubnet=0.0.0.0/0 leftauth=psk right=%any rightdns=8.8.8.8, 8.8.4.4 rightauth=psk psk="your_psk"
请将your_psk
替换为您的预共享密钥。
3. 启动L2TP VPN服务
启动L2TP VPN服务:
sudo ipsec up L2TP-PSK
查看L2TP VPN服务状态:
sudo ipsec status
4. 配置客户端连接L2TP VPN
在客户端设备上,按照以下步骤配置L2TP VPN连接:
1、打开网络连接设置,添加新的VPN连接。
2、选择L2TP/IPsec VPN。
3、输入VPN服务器地址、用户名和密码。
4、输入预共享密钥。
5、完成配置后,点击“连接”。
5. 测试L2TP VPN连接
连接成功后,可以在客户端设备上进行测试:
1、打开终端。
2、执行命令查看当前公网IP地址:curl ifconfig.me
3、执行命令查看当前内网IP地址:ifconfig
如果客户端设备显示的内网IP地址与服务器相同,说明L2TP VPN连接成功。
本文详细介绍了在Kali Linux下配置L2TP VPN的方法,通过配置L2TP VPN,您不仅能保护个人隐私,还能确保数据传输的安全性,在实际应用中,请根据您的具体需求调整配置参数。
标签: #kali vpn l2tp #IPsec VPN
评论列表